[VOL-3624] Passing KV_STORE_DATAPATH_PREFIX to ofAgent
Change-Id: I1b6093cff43e18c7c8617065fac46016ee71e2a1
diff --git a/voltha/Chart.yaml b/voltha/Chart.yaml
index ee6c38d..5e7600d 100644
--- a/voltha/Chart.yaml
+++ b/voltha/Chart.yaml
@@ -14,7 +14,7 @@
---
apiVersion: "v1"
name: "voltha"
-version: "2.7.0-dev"
+version: "2.7.1"
description: "A Helm chart for Voltha based on K8S resources in Voltha project"
keywords:
- "onf"
diff --git a/voltha/templates/ofagent-deploy.yaml b/voltha/templates/ofagent-deploy.yaml
index 7aae6f2..234e965 100644
--- a/voltha/templates/ofagent-deploy.yaml
+++ b/voltha/templates/ofagent-deploy.yaml
@@ -72,10 +72,12 @@
image: '{{ tpl .Values.images.ofagent.registry . }}{{ tpl .Values.images.ofagent.repository . }}:{{ tpl .Values.images.ofagent.tag . }}'
imagePullPolicy: {{ tpl .Values.images.ofagent.pullPolicy . }}
env:
- - name: COMPONENT_NAME
- valueFrom:
- fieldRef:
- fieldPath: metadata.labels['app.kubernetes.io/name']
+ - name: COMPONENT_NAME
+ valueFrom:
+ fieldRef:
+ fieldPath: metadata.labels['app.kubernetes.io/name']
+ - name: KV_STORE_DATAPATH_PREFIX
+ value: {{ .Values.defaults.kv_store_data_prefix }}
args:
- "/app/ofagent"
{{- range .Values.services.controller }}
diff --git a/voltha/values.yaml b/voltha/values.yaml
index 09e3942..fd0f86d 100644
--- a/voltha/values.yaml
+++ b/voltha/values.yaml
@@ -96,7 +96,7 @@
ofagent:
registry: '{{ .Values.defaults.image_registry }}'
repository: '{{ .Values.defaults.image_org }}voltha-ofagent-go'
- tag: '{{- if hasKey .Values.defaults "image_tag" }}{{- if .Values.defaults.image_tag }}{{ .Values.defaults.image_tag }}{{- else }}1.3.1{{- end }}{{- else }}1.3.1{{- end }}'
+ tag: '{{- if hasKey .Values.defaults "image_tag" }}{{- if .Values.defaults.image_tag }}{{ .Values.defaults.image_tag }}{{- else }}1.4.1{{- end }}{{- else }}1.4.1{{- end }}'
pullPolicy: '{{ .Values.defaults.image_pullPolicy }}'
rw_core: